2. American Medical Association Guides to the Evaluation of Permanent Impairment, 4th Edition, p98 , 1993. Loss of motion segment integrity is defined as an antero-posterior motion or slipping of one vertebra over another greater than 3.5mm for a cervical vertebra...or a difference in the angular motion of two adjacent motion segments greater that 11 degrees in response to spine flexion and extension. From page 109, Table 71. DRE Impairment Category Differentiators ...The more objective and important differentiators are marked with an asterisk; the physician should use these to determine the highest impairment category. 5.*Loss of Motion Segment Integrity From page 110, Table 73. DRE Cervicothoracic Spine Impairment categories* DRE Impairment category IVLoss of motion segment integrity 25% impairment of the whole person.
